Position JMenuItem

Position JMenuItem - Java - Programmation

Marsh Posté le 13-03-2010 à 00:10:29    

Bonsoir,
 
Depuis un moment j'ai un bug,  
j'utilise la jmf qui me permet de lire des videos mais lors de la lecture les subItems(JMenuItem) sont en arrière plan,
la videos prend toujour le dessus; je voudrais que les JMenuItems soit en premier plan.
 
J'ai testé componentZorder, cette propriété ne fonctionne pas (la video étant rafraichi a chaque image)
il faudrait définir le panel de la video en arrière plan.
 
pouvez-vous m'aider merci

Reply

Marsh Posté le 13-03-2010 à 00:10:29   

Reply

Marsh Posté le 15-03-2010 à 09:40:10    

Bonjour, j'imagine que ça vient du fait que ton composant permettant de lire la vidéo est un composant lourd.
 
Il faut que tu spécifies à ton JPopupMenu de se comporter également de la sorte.
 
tonJPopupMenu.setLightWeightPopupEnabled(false);  

Reply

Marsh Posté le 16-03-2010 à 18:14:44    

remk22 a écrit :

Bonjour, j'imagine que ça vient du fait que ton composant permettant de lire la vidéo est un composant lourd.
 
Il faut que tu spécifies à ton JPopupMenu de se comporter également de la sorte.
 
tonJPopupMenu.setLightWeightPopupEnabled(false);  


Code :
  1. barreMenu = new JMenuBar();
  2. this.setJMenuBar(barreMenu);


 
j'utilise JMenuBar, je ne connais pas le composant JPopupMenu

Reply

Marsh Posté le 18-03-2010 à 13:40:45    

Après normalement dans ta jMenuBar tu rajoutes des JMenu.
 
sur ces JMenu tu fait :
monJMenu.getPopupMenu().setLightWeightPopupEnabled(false);  

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ed